Maintenance Playbook

Book a pump every 4 years for typical households; reduce the interval with large families or disposal use. Stagger laundry loads, limit bleach-heavy cleaners, and keep wipes out of the system.

Move roof runoff away from the drain field. Maintain grass cover, avoid heavy vehicles, and flag lids so service is swift. Store permits and past reports for a complete history.

The absorption area may be buried, but it is the core of the system. We help Somerset County ME owners to protect it by keeping grass cover, moving roof water, and stopping heavy loads. If absorption slows, we jet laterals, adjust dosing, and monitor recovery before suggesting replacement.

Somerset County is a county in the state of Maine, United States. As of the 2020 census, the population was 50,477. Its county seat is Skowhegan.
